  • Zabbix proxy is a major component in the whole Zabbix architecture. As a result, very often failure of one proxy can lead to dramatic results in all monitoring setup causing a storm of events and problems sent to engineers. In this video, we talk about multiple real-life cases that cause these problems and briefly go through how to troubleshoot these cases and eventually completely fix the problems and avoid them in the future.

      @@DmitryLambert Correct, I was thinking more of "does my base network stack work?" I work in a heavily firewalled environment, with a few dozen admins who connect agents to our Zabbix environment. So the question of "is it the network?" comes up often. So much that I've written a distributed tool that when supplied a IP, connects to each proxy and supplies a destination IP and optional port. Each proxy pings, does an nmap on the agent port (default 10050), and executes a zabbix_get on the system.uname key and reports back the results to the tool. Basically testing all layers for my users.

    Is data saved if zabbix server is down for 12 hours? Will the proxy transfer data to the server when the server becomes available?
    Will the proxy server be able to provide a "fallback node" while maintaining metrics? Will it transfer data to the server?
    If there is material on this topic, I would be grateful

    • @DmitryLambert
      @DmitryLambert  3 года назад +1

      Proxy stores 1 hour of data by default, but that can be changed in configuration file.
      Yes, data will be sent when communication will be restored. And no there is no fallback mechanism
